Influence of kepok banana bunch as new cellulose source on thermal, mechanical, and biodegradability properties of Thai cassava starch/polyvinyl alcohol hybrid‐based bioplastic

Nelga Autha,
Febriana Esza Dewi Siregar,
Harmiansyah
et al.

Abstract: Bioplastics were developed to overcome environmental problems that are difficult to decompose in the environment. This study analyzes Thai cassava starch‐based bioplastics' tensile strength, biodegradability, moisture absorption, and thermal stability. This study used Thai cassava starch and polyvinyl alcohol (PVA) as matrices, whereas Kepok banana bunch cellulose was employed as a filler.
